excel 为什么会越变越大
作者:百问excel教程网
|
273人看过
发布时间:2026-01-25 20:24:40
标签:
Excel 为什么会越变越大?揭秘数据处理中的性能瓶颈与优化之道在数据处理与分析的领域中,Excel 作为一款广受欢迎的办公软件,其功能丰富、操作便捷,满足了绝大多数用户的日常需求。然而,随着数据量的不断增长,Excel 的性能问题逐
Excel 为什么会越变越大?揭秘数据处理中的性能瓶颈与优化之道
在数据处理与分析的领域中,Excel 作为一款广受欢迎的办公软件,其功能丰富、操作便捷,满足了绝大多数用户的日常需求。然而,随着数据量的不断增长,Excel 的性能问题逐渐显现,尤其是“Excel 为什么会越变越大”这一问题,成为许多用户关注的焦点。本文将从多个角度深入探讨 Excel 为何在使用过程中出现“变大”的现象,并提供实用的优化建议。
一、Excel 的本质与数据存储机制
Excel 是基于 二进制格式 的电子表格软件,其核心数据存储方式是 二维表格。每一行代表一个数据单元格,每一列代表一个字段,数据以 行和列的方式存储。这种存储方式虽然简单直观,但在大规模数据处理时,会带来一定的性能问题。
Excel 的数据存储本质上是基于 内存中的数组,数据被组织成一个二维数组,每一行数据被存储为一个一维数组。当数据量增大时,Excel 需要更多的内存来存储这些数据,从而导致文件体积的增大。
二、Excel 文件体积增大的主要原因
1. 数据量的增加
Excel 文件本质上是存储数据的文件,数据的增加直接导致文件体积的增大。无论是新建的表格,还是在现有表格中添加新的数据,文件中存储的数据量都会随之增加。
示例:如果一个 Excel 文件包含 1000 行 100 列的数据,文件大小大约为 1MB 左右。而如果数据量增加到 100,000 行 100 列,文件大小可能达到 100MB。
2. 数据类型与格式的复杂性
Excel 支持多种数据类型,如文本、数字、日期、公式、图表等。不同的数据类型在存储时占用不同的内存空间,数据格式的复杂性也会增加文件的体积。
示例:如果一个 Excel 文件中包含大量日期和时间数据,每个日期占 8 字节,那么 1000 个日期将占用 8,000 字节,远远超过简单的数字存储。
3. 数据格式的复杂性
Excel 文件在保存时,会自动进行格式调整,如应用样式、设置字体、调整列宽等。这些格式设置会增加文件的体积。
示例:如果一个表格有 100 行 10 列,但每列都有不同的字体、颜色、边框等设置,文件体积将显著增加。
4. 数据的持久化存储
Excel 文件本质上是存储在磁盘上的文件,当数据被写入磁盘时,文件体积会随数据量的增加而增大。此外,Excel 会将数据保存为 二进制格式,而非文本格式,这也会导致文件体积的增加。
示例:一个包含 1000 行 100 列的 Excel 文件,如果以文本格式保存,体积可能比二进制格式小,但若使用二进制格式保存,体积可能更大。
三、Excel 文件体积增大的具体表现
1. 文件大小明显增长
当用户在 Excel 中添加新数据或修改现有数据时,文件体积会明显增加。这种增长是不可逆的,因为 Excel 会将数据存储为二进制格式,而非原始文本格式。
2. 导出与共享时文件体积变大
当 Excel 文件被导出为其他格式(如 PDF、Word、图片等)时,文件体积通常会变大。这是因为导出过程中需要将数据转换为其他格式,增加存储空间。
3. 软件运行时的内存占用增加
Excel 在运行时会占用大量的内存,尤其是当数据量较大时。内存的占用不仅影响运行速度,也会影响系统资源的分配。
四、Excel 文件体积增大的原因分析
1. 数据量的增加
Excel 的文件体积与数据量成正比,数据越多,文件体积越大。因此,用户在使用 Excel 时,若数据量增加,文件体积也会随之增加。
2. 数据格式的复杂性
Excel 支持多种数据格式,如文本、数字、公式、日期等。在数据格式复杂的情况下,文件体积会显著增加。
3. 数据的持久化存储
Excel 的文件本质上是存储在磁盘上的,数据的持久化存储会导致文件体积的增大。
4. 软件本身的存储机制
Excel 的存储机制是基于 二进制格式,这种存储方式在数据量增加时,文件体积也会随之增加。
五、Excel 文件体积增大的影响
1. 文件存储空间的占用增加
Excel 文件体积的增大,意味着需要更多的存储空间。对于企业或个人用户来说,这可能是一个重要的问题。
2. 文件处理速度变慢
当 Excel 文件体积增大时,文件的读取和处理速度会变慢,影响用户的使用体验。
3. 系统资源的占用增加
Excel 在运行时会占用大量的系统资源,包括内存和CPU。文件体积的增大,会导致系统资源的占用增加,影响其他程序的运行。
4. 文件的导出和共享变得更加困难
当 Excel 文件体积增大时,导出为其他格式时,文件体积也会变大,影响文件的分享和传输。
六、Excel 文件体积增大的优化策略
1. 数据量的控制
用户可以通过以下方式控制数据量:
- 减少数据输入:避免在 Excel 中输入大量数据。
- 批量导入数据:使用 Excel 的“数据”功能,批量导入数据,减少手动输入。
- 使用数据库:将数据存储在数据库中,减少 Excel 文件的存储量。
2. 数据格式的优化
用户可以通过以下方式优化数据格式:
- 统一数据格式:确保所有数据使用相同的数据类型(如统一为数字、日期等)。
- 减少格式设置:避免设置字体、颜色、边框等格式,以减少文件体积。
- 使用公式代替手动输入:使用公式自动计算数据,减少手动输入的量。
3. 文件存储方式的优化
用户可以通过以下方式优化文件存储方式:
- 使用二进制格式:Excel 本身使用二进制格式存储数据,这在数据量较大时,文件体积会增加。
- 使用压缩文件:使用 Excel 的“压缩”功能,减少文件体积。
- 使用云存储:将 Excel 文件存储在云平台上,如 OneDrive、Google Drive,减少本地存储的占用。
4. 使用高级功能
用户可以通过以下方式提高 Excel 的性能:
- 使用公式和函数:使用公式和函数自动计算数据,减少数据量。
- 使用高级筛选:使用高级筛选功能,减少数据量。
- 使用数据透视表:使用数据透视表进行数据汇总,减少数据量。
七、Excel 文件体积增大的未来趋势
随着数据量的不断增长,Excel 文件体积增大的问题将越来越突出。未来,Excel 的开发者可能会推出新的功能,如 智能数据压缩、自动优化存储等,以解决文件体积增大的问题。
此外,随着云计算和数据处理技术的发展,Excel 的存储方式也将发生变化,用户可以通过云存储和数据处理工具,减少本地存储的负担。
八、
Excel 作为一款广泛应用的办公软件,其文件体积的增大是不可避免的。然而,用户可以通过控制数据量、优化数据格式、使用高级功能等方式,减少文件体积,提高文件的运行效率。未来,随着技术的发展,Excel 的存储方式和性能也将不断优化,以满足用户日益增长的需求。
在使用 Excel 的过程中,用户应合理管理数据,避免文件体积过大,从而提高工作效率,减少存储负担。
在数据处理与分析的领域中,Excel 作为一款广受欢迎的办公软件,其功能丰富、操作便捷,满足了绝大多数用户的日常需求。然而,随着数据量的不断增长,Excel 的性能问题逐渐显现,尤其是“Excel 为什么会越变越大”这一问题,成为许多用户关注的焦点。本文将从多个角度深入探讨 Excel 为何在使用过程中出现“变大”的现象,并提供实用的优化建议。
一、Excel 的本质与数据存储机制
Excel 是基于 二进制格式 的电子表格软件,其核心数据存储方式是 二维表格。每一行代表一个数据单元格,每一列代表一个字段,数据以 行和列的方式存储。这种存储方式虽然简单直观,但在大规模数据处理时,会带来一定的性能问题。
Excel 的数据存储本质上是基于 内存中的数组,数据被组织成一个二维数组,每一行数据被存储为一个一维数组。当数据量增大时,Excel 需要更多的内存来存储这些数据,从而导致文件体积的增大。
二、Excel 文件体积增大的主要原因
1. 数据量的增加
Excel 文件本质上是存储数据的文件,数据的增加直接导致文件体积的增大。无论是新建的表格,还是在现有表格中添加新的数据,文件中存储的数据量都会随之增加。
示例:如果一个 Excel 文件包含 1000 行 100 列的数据,文件大小大约为 1MB 左右。而如果数据量增加到 100,000 行 100 列,文件大小可能达到 100MB。
2. 数据类型与格式的复杂性
Excel 支持多种数据类型,如文本、数字、日期、公式、图表等。不同的数据类型在存储时占用不同的内存空间,数据格式的复杂性也会增加文件的体积。
示例:如果一个 Excel 文件中包含大量日期和时间数据,每个日期占 8 字节,那么 1000 个日期将占用 8,000 字节,远远超过简单的数字存储。
3. 数据格式的复杂性
Excel 文件在保存时,会自动进行格式调整,如应用样式、设置字体、调整列宽等。这些格式设置会增加文件的体积。
示例:如果一个表格有 100 行 10 列,但每列都有不同的字体、颜色、边框等设置,文件体积将显著增加。
4. 数据的持久化存储
Excel 文件本质上是存储在磁盘上的文件,当数据被写入磁盘时,文件体积会随数据量的增加而增大。此外,Excel 会将数据保存为 二进制格式,而非文本格式,这也会导致文件体积的增加。
示例:一个包含 1000 行 100 列的 Excel 文件,如果以文本格式保存,体积可能比二进制格式小,但若使用二进制格式保存,体积可能更大。
三、Excel 文件体积增大的具体表现
1. 文件大小明显增长
当用户在 Excel 中添加新数据或修改现有数据时,文件体积会明显增加。这种增长是不可逆的,因为 Excel 会将数据存储为二进制格式,而非原始文本格式。
2. 导出与共享时文件体积变大
当 Excel 文件被导出为其他格式(如 PDF、Word、图片等)时,文件体积通常会变大。这是因为导出过程中需要将数据转换为其他格式,增加存储空间。
3. 软件运行时的内存占用增加
Excel 在运行时会占用大量的内存,尤其是当数据量较大时。内存的占用不仅影响运行速度,也会影响系统资源的分配。
四、Excel 文件体积增大的原因分析
1. 数据量的增加
Excel 的文件体积与数据量成正比,数据越多,文件体积越大。因此,用户在使用 Excel 时,若数据量增加,文件体积也会随之增加。
2. 数据格式的复杂性
Excel 支持多种数据格式,如文本、数字、公式、日期等。在数据格式复杂的情况下,文件体积会显著增加。
3. 数据的持久化存储
Excel 的文件本质上是存储在磁盘上的,数据的持久化存储会导致文件体积的增大。
4. 软件本身的存储机制
Excel 的存储机制是基于 二进制格式,这种存储方式在数据量增加时,文件体积也会随之增加。
五、Excel 文件体积增大的影响
1. 文件存储空间的占用增加
Excel 文件体积的增大,意味着需要更多的存储空间。对于企业或个人用户来说,这可能是一个重要的问题。
2. 文件处理速度变慢
当 Excel 文件体积增大时,文件的读取和处理速度会变慢,影响用户的使用体验。
3. 系统资源的占用增加
Excel 在运行时会占用大量的系统资源,包括内存和CPU。文件体积的增大,会导致系统资源的占用增加,影响其他程序的运行。
4. 文件的导出和共享变得更加困难
当 Excel 文件体积增大时,导出为其他格式时,文件体积也会变大,影响文件的分享和传输。
六、Excel 文件体积增大的优化策略
1. 数据量的控制
用户可以通过以下方式控制数据量:
- 减少数据输入:避免在 Excel 中输入大量数据。
- 批量导入数据:使用 Excel 的“数据”功能,批量导入数据,减少手动输入。
- 使用数据库:将数据存储在数据库中,减少 Excel 文件的存储量。
2. 数据格式的优化
用户可以通过以下方式优化数据格式:
- 统一数据格式:确保所有数据使用相同的数据类型(如统一为数字、日期等)。
- 减少格式设置:避免设置字体、颜色、边框等格式,以减少文件体积。
- 使用公式代替手动输入:使用公式自动计算数据,减少手动输入的量。
3. 文件存储方式的优化
用户可以通过以下方式优化文件存储方式:
- 使用二进制格式:Excel 本身使用二进制格式存储数据,这在数据量较大时,文件体积会增加。
- 使用压缩文件:使用 Excel 的“压缩”功能,减少文件体积。
- 使用云存储:将 Excel 文件存储在云平台上,如 OneDrive、Google Drive,减少本地存储的占用。
4. 使用高级功能
用户可以通过以下方式提高 Excel 的性能:
- 使用公式和函数:使用公式和函数自动计算数据,减少数据量。
- 使用高级筛选:使用高级筛选功能,减少数据量。
- 使用数据透视表:使用数据透视表进行数据汇总,减少数据量。
七、Excel 文件体积增大的未来趋势
随着数据量的不断增长,Excel 文件体积增大的问题将越来越突出。未来,Excel 的开发者可能会推出新的功能,如 智能数据压缩、自动优化存储等,以解决文件体积增大的问题。
此外,随着云计算和数据处理技术的发展,Excel 的存储方式也将发生变化,用户可以通过云存储和数据处理工具,减少本地存储的负担。
八、
Excel 作为一款广泛应用的办公软件,其文件体积的增大是不可避免的。然而,用户可以通过控制数据量、优化数据格式、使用高级功能等方式,减少文件体积,提高文件的运行效率。未来,随着技术的发展,Excel 的存储方式和性能也将不断优化,以满足用户日益增长的需求。
在使用 Excel 的过程中,用户应合理管理数据,避免文件体积过大,从而提高工作效率,减少存储负担。
推荐文章
下载Excel的密钥是什么意思在使用Excel进行数据处理、表格制作或工作表编辑时,用户常常会遇到“下载Excel的密钥是什么意思”的疑问。这一问题通常出现在下载软件、激活许可证或使用特定功能时。下面将从多个角度深入解析“下载Exce
2026-01-25 20:24:35
42人看过
为什么Excel表格都变成PDF?在数字化办公环境中,Excel表格已成为企业、个人及团队处理数据的重要工具。然而,一个普遍的现象出现在许多用户使用Excel后,表格内容会自动转换为PDF格式。这种现象看似简单,实则背后涉及多个层面的
2026-01-25 20:24:34
193人看过
什么是Excel文件的页签?在使用Excel进行数据处理与管理时,一个常见的操作是打开多个工作表,每个工作表都被称为“页签”。页签是Excel文件中用于组织和管理不同数据区域的工具,它可以帮助用户更高效地进行数据操作和查看。本篇
2026-01-25 20:24:28
294人看过
Excel 数据验证有什么用?Excel 是一个功能强大的电子表格工具,广泛用于数据处理、分析和管理。在使用 Excel 过程中,数据验证功能是一个非常实用的工具,它可以帮助用户确保输入的数据符合一定的规则和条件,从而提高数据的准确性
2026-01-25 20:24:27
395人看过
.webp)
.webp)

.webp)